Method and device for load balancing based on RRC connection

The invention discloses a method and device for load balancing based on an RRC connection, used for realizing the load balancing timely in a multi-layer network. The method for load balancing based on the RRC connection comprises the following steps: when a preset balancing period is reached, determining whether the states of all terminals in a first cell that successfully establish the RRC connection satisfy the predetermined balancing condition or not; if the predetermined balancing condition is satisfied, screening out the terminals to be balanced according to the preset filter conditions; and cutting into the balancing target cell successively according to the preset priority order. According to the invention, the balancing process is performed periodically according to the preset balancing period, therefore, the timeliness of the load balancing is ensured; whether the cell needs load balancing or not is determined based on the number of the terminals that successfully establish the RRC connection, therefore, the high load cell can be found and handled timely; the terminal to be balanced is selected specially by means of the filter conditions, and the balancing is performed successively according to the preset priority order, therefore, the business experience of the balanced terminal is guaranteed, and the impact on non-balanced terminals is reduced.

TV, Broadband and Telephone Transmission System Based on CATV HFC Network

The invention discloses a TV, broadband and telephone transmission system based on a cable TV HFC network, including backbone equipment, corridor unit equipment and user home equipment; the backbone equipment room is connected to the corridor unit, and the corridor unit is connected to the The user's home equipment; the backbone computer room equipment converts the HDTV IP signal into an optical signal of an intermediate frequency signal, and the corridor unit equipment will receive the CATV optical signal, the optical signal of the intermediate frequency signal and the IP signal and convert the CATV optical signal Signal and the optical signal of the intermediate frequency signal are converted into respective radio frequency signals, and the optical signal of the IP signal is modulated into EOC signals, 3G signals and WIFI signals, and the corridor unit equipment mixes and distributes CATV radio frequency signals and intermediate frequency signals according to users The radio frequency signal, the EOC signal, the 3G signal and the WIFI signal, the user home equipment distributes the mixed signal transmitted by the corridor unit equipment according to the room, and can realize the transmission of TV on the cable TV HFC network at the same time , broadband, and telephone signals, so that the previous three networks can realize the integration of three networks in one function, and the construction cost of the network system is greatly reduced.

Terminal management method, terminal management system, computer equipment and storage medium

The invention belongs to the technical field of 5G wireless communication systems, and discloses a terminal management method, a terminal management system, computer equipment and a storage medium, which identify a terminal entering an Inactive state according to the service characteristics of the terminal, and determine whether the terminal enters the Inactive state by judging whether the servicecharacteristics are regular and whether the TA is changed or not or whether the terminal is moved or not. The method comprises the following steps of determining whether to transmit packet data by adopting a resource pre-allocation mode or a random access signaling mode, and transmitting the packet data by adopting the random access signaling mode, and transmitting the packet data in a radio notification area (RNA) updating process or switching process; the source base station can carry the identifier that the terminal can enter the Inactive state and can transmit the packet data to the target base station in a random access signaling mode. According to the method, delay can be well achieved, the service experience can be ensured, wireless resources can be effectively utilized, and the energy-saving effect of the terminal can be achieved.

Method and system for video coding in visual phones in mobile terminals, and mobile terminal

The invention discloses a method and a system for video coding in visual phones in mobile terminals, and a mobile terminal. The method comprises: calculating the bit error rate of video data currentlyreceived; determining the coding-quality level of the video data currently received according to the bit error rate, wherein the bit error rate is in inverse proportion to the coding-quality level; and coding the video data currently received according to the coding-quality level. The method can also determine the coding-quality level of the video data according to current network-signal state inorder to perform coding, wherein the network-signal state is proportional to the coding-quality level. The method controls the coding of the video data according to the bit error rate and/or the network-signal state which are the main factors causing drop call, and different bit error rates and/or network-signal states correspond to different coding-quality levels, while different coding-qualitylevels correspond to different amount of coded data. Therefore, the method greatly reduces the drop-call rate of visual phones so as to guarantee the normal communication and service experience of thevisual phones.
